    Abstract: A computing device comprising a processor is configured to perform the techniques of this disclosure. The processor may duplicate a first node of a tree data structure to create a duplicate node, and create an inbound edge of the duplicate node to a parent node of the first node and an outbound edge to at least one child node of the first node. The processor may receive an update to the at least one child node of the first node. In response to determining that the at least one child node has multiple parent nodes, the processor may duplicate the at least one child node to create a duplicate child node, create an outbound edge of the duplicate node to the duplicate child node, delete the outbound edge of the duplicate node to the at least one child node, and perform the update to the at least one child node.

    Abstract: A system and method for calculating an estimate of a body condition score (BCS) for a bovine animal is described. The system comprises a visual spectrum camera configured to collect visual spectrum data of the animal in an area of interest, an infra-red camera configured to collect near infra-red spectrum data of the animal related to soft tissue distribution around the area of interest, and one or more neural networks trained using a first training dataset comprising combined imaging data for each of a plurality of animals and corresponding BCS's for the plurality of animals, in which the combined imaging data for each animal comprises the visual spectrum data and the near infra-red spectrum data for the animal. The system also includes a processor configured to: receive the combined imaging data for the animal and apply the one or more neural networks to the combined imaging data for the animal to calculate an estimate of a BCS for the animal.

    Abstract: A fixture for supporting an article (e.g., a guitar such as a Stratocaster® guitar body) and controlling the position of the article relative to a print head to allow a contoured portion of a surface of the article to be printed by the print head. The fixture may include a pivot axis about which the article is pivotal. A cam surface may be engaged by the article and/or a bracket of the fixture to which the article is affixed to prescribe the controlled movement of the article based on relative movement between the article and the print head. In turn, both planar and contoured portions of the guitar surface may be printed during a single print operation.

    Abstract: A kit for preparing a nucleic acid sample for analysis by liquid chromatography tandem mass spectrometry (LC-MS/MS) is provided, the kit comprising: a lyophilized enzyme composition comprising: micrococcal nuclease; nuclease P1; and bacterial alkaline phosphatase (BAP); and a digestion buffer. Also provided are enzyme compositions and methods of use for rapid, efficient preparation of a nucleic acid sample for analysis by LC-MS/MS, without the need for denaturation of the sample.
